The main difference between the Indian number system and International number system is the placement of the separators or comas. In international numbering system, millions are written after thousands while in Indian system, lakhs are written after thousands. ... It has a three digit split in the numbers. When two numbers are added together, the result is called a sum. The two numbers being added together are called addends. The two values in an addition problem are called "addends" and the answer is called the "sum." Addition (usually signified by the plus symbol +) is one of the four basic operations of arithmetic, the other three being subtraction, multiplication and division. The addition of two whole numbers results in the total amount or sum of those values combined. ... Addition belongs to arithmetic, a branch of mathematics.

An axil is the angle between the upper side of a leaf and the stem from which it grows.
The location of the axil helps you to locate the bud because in flowering plants buds develop in the axils of leaves. These types of buds are known as axillary buds.
